Hi community
When is the best time to weigh yourself? I weighed myself last night and I weighed myself this morning and there was a 0.8kg difference. The morning weigh in was less; so do I take that as my true weight?

    You weigh in the morning, after a BM. You are always going to weigh more in the evening.

    you'll get the most accurate weight in the morning, after using the bathroom and before showering or consuming anything

    The time of day doesn't matter. Just be consistent and weigh yourself at whatever time you choose. That'll be morning for most.

    Also, you don't have to weight just once a week because it may be discouraging. For example, one day I may weight 149 and the very next day I could weigh 153 depending on how I ate the day before (high sodium for example). If my weigh in day was the 153 day I might feel bad. But yeah, weigh as often as you'd like and be mindful of other things that can effect (affect?)weight.
